(#) Admission cost of €2.00 for EU citizens between the ages of 18 and under 25. The reduced tariff is also valid for citizens of countries outside the European Union “holders of the residence permit in Italy issued for the reasons indicated on the website of the Ministry of Foreign Affairs”

(*) For those who are in possession of a Pompeii express ticket, additional access to the Suburban Villas route (Ville dei Misteri + Villa di Diomede + Villa Regina and Antiquarium in Boscoreale) is possible by purchasing an additional ticket at a cost of €8 – card payment only – directly at the start of the route at the Herculaneum Gate – Street of the Tombs entrance. Please note that the suburban villas route cannot be purchased individually, but only by either purchasing the Pompeii+ ticket (€22) or by supplementing the Pompeii Express ticket (€18) with an additional ticket (€8), which can be purchased directly – card payment only – at the start of the route at the Herculaneum Gate – Street of the Tombs entrance

Free ticket every first Sunday of the month:

on these free Sundays (the first of every month), in order to prevent overcrowding which could put the safety and protection of both the site and visitors in jeopardy, and to optimise visitor flow, should the number of visitors exceed 15,000 by 12:00, the ticket offices will close for an hour.

Reduced (18-24 years old) and Free (under 18 years old and other specified categories) tickets cannot be purchased in advance. In this case, buyers will have to go to the Archaeological Park’s ticket office to show their document entitling them to free admission (identity card or other document proving the right to free admission).

The free ticket for a single access must be requested at the physical ticket office.

 

Community MyPompeii

Pompeii is renewing its annual pass for site visits at an even more competitive rate. It is a new way to experience Pompeii and the sites of the Archaeological Park, at a price which is affordable for all, and with the opportunity to participate in and to be informed about ongoing initiatives.

The MyPompeii card, which is valid for one year, it costs  €35 (€8 for under 25s, 25 years not completed and EU citizens) + €1,50 online pre-sale and is valid for all of the sites of the Archaeological Park of Pompeii (Pompeii, the Villa of Poppaea/Oplontis, the Antiquarium of Boscoreale and Villa Regina, the Stabian Villas and the Libero D’Orsi Archaeological Museum/the Royal Palace of Quisisana).

Members of the MyPompeii community will receive advance notification of the latest news, as well as of the ordinary and extraordinary activities of the Park, will be able to interact and offer suggestions and proposals, and will also be invited to participate in an annual meeting with the Director of the Park, to be updated on current and future initiatives.

It will be possible to purchase the pass online at the www.ticketone.it website, for subsequent collection at the Pompeii ticket offices (at Porta Marina, Piazza Esedra and Piazza Anfiteatro). The card, which features the owner’s name and is non-transferable, will be valid for one year from the date of issue, and will – upon display of an identity document – permit unlimited admission to all sites of the Archaeological Park of Pompeii, as well as to current temporary exhibitions and to certain special and exclusive events, which will be communicated periodically.The card will be valid during ordinary opening days and times. Initiatives which are not managed by the Park and which are not included in the regular ticketing or scheduling will not be covered by the pass.

Those in possession of a pass which is still within its period of validity will be able to take advantage of the same conditions as those provided by the MyPompeii card.

TICKET

Entrance tickets can be purchased online at the website www.ticketone.it. The official ticket offices of the Pompeii Archaeological Park are located only within the archaeological area, at the entrances Porta Marina, Piazza Anfiteatro and Piazza Esedra.

We recommend purchasing tickets in advance to speed up entry to the Archaeological Park. Those who buy in advance will receive their ticket in PDF format, that can be printed out or shown on their smart phone, and they can go directly to the turnstiles at the entrance to the Archaeological Park.

Reduced (18-24 years old) and Free (under 18 years old and other specified categories) tickets cannot be purchased in advance. In this case, buyers will have to go to the Archaeological Park’s ticket office to show their document entitling them to free admission (identity card or other document proving the right to free admission).

It’s possible to purchase tickets for entry to Pompeii and other sites of Archaeological Park by phone. It’s possible to call 081 18658177 (email info@tosc.it), from Monday to Friday, from 9.30 to 18.00. Telephone pre-sale cost €1.50. It will be possible to pay with VISA, Mastercard, AMEX and, exclusively for Groups and Schools, also bank transfer. ACCESS TO THE SITE and VISITABLE BUILDINGS

It will be possible to enter the site from Porta Marina entrance, from Piazza Anfiteatro entrance and from Piazza Esedra entrance.

To access the Antiquarium, we recommend the entrance from Piazza Esedra which is included in the entrance ticket.

APP MY POMPEII

In order to ensure a safe visit, we suggest the app MyPompeii (on Apple store or Google Play store) which, once downloaded, will allow you to scan the ticket QR Code and start the tour inside the site. You will also have the chance to view, on a map, in real time, the number of people visiting the site to avoid crowds.
